Emergency services respond after a shooting in Clondalkin, Dublin, with a man in his 40s taken to hospital. According to reports, the incident occurs at around 8:55pm at St Killian’s Park in Clondalkin. Gardaí are investigating the circumstances surrounding the discharge of a firearm at a vehicle at the location. The available reporting does not provide further details on the motive, the extent of damage to the vehicle, or the man’s condition. Following the incident, emergency responders attend the scene and transport the injured man to hospital for medical treatment. Gardaí continue inquiries to determine what led to the shooting and whether other people were involved. No additional confirmed information is provided in the sources about arrests or suspected parties at this stage.
